MetaGPT takes the concept of "Agent" to the next level by simulating a Software Company. It doesn't just give you one AI; it gives you a team: a Product Manager, an Architect, a Project Manager, an Engineer, and a QA Engineer.
The core philosophy of MetaGPT is Code = SOP(Team). It believes that high-quality software comes from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s). By assigning specific roles to different LLM instances and forcing them to produce structured outputs (PRDs, UML diagrams, API specs) before writing code, MetaGPT drastically reduces hallucinations and logic errors.
MetaGPT forces agents to communicate via standardized documents, not chat.
You can literally watch the agents "talk" to each other. The Architect might reject the PM's requirements as unfeasible. The QA might reject the Engineer's code. This adversarial process improves quality.

AutoGPT started in 2023 as a viral GitHub repository—a simple python script that chained GPT-4 calls to "do anything." By 2026, it has transformed into a sophisticated Agent Builder Platform. It is no longer just a "coding tool"; it is a platform for creating, deploying, and managing specialized AI agents for any task (marketing, research, coding, social media).
The introduction of the AutoGPT Server and the AutoGPT Builder (a visual, block-based interface) has democratized agent creation. You don't need to write Python to build an agent; you can drag and drop blocks like "Search Google," "Read File," "Summarize," and "Post to Slack."
Imagine "Scratch" or "Zapier" but for AI Agents.
AutoGPT now hosts a marketplace where you can download pre-built agents.
